Broadband & Connectivity

Buckhurst Hill offers faster average downloads at 459.3 Mbps, compared to 62.0 Mbps in City And County Of The City Of London. Superfast coverage (30 Mbps+) reaches 99.1% of premises in Buckhurst Hill and 10.9% in City And County Of The City Of London. Gigabit availability stands at 89.1% in Buckhurst Hill and 8.5% in City And County Of The City Of London.

Buckhurst Hill is the faster of the two by 641% on average download speed (459 vs 62 Mbps).

Energy Efficiency & Running Costs

Homes in City And County Of The City Of London are more energy-efficient on average, with an EPC score of 72.9 (band C) versus 70.6 (band C) in Buckhurst Hill. Estimated annual energy costs average £1,152 in Buckhurst Hill and £798 in City And County Of The City Of London. 63% of homes in Buckhurst Hill have an EPC rating of C or above, compared to 77.2% in City And County Of The City Of London.

City And County Of The City Of London has more energy-efficient housing — 77.2% reach band C or above, vs 63% in the other.

Demographics & Economy

Median household income is £40,915.3 in City And County Of The City Of London and £36,572 in Buckhurst Hill. The median age is 41 in Buckhurst Hill and 36.6 in City And County Of The City Of London. Employment rates stand at 59.2% in Buckhurst Hill and 63.8% in City And County Of The City Of London. Owner-occupancy is 63.3% in Buckhurst Hill versus 27.7% in City And County Of The City Of London.
